Sneed is one of the best zone cover corners in the NFL. According to Next Gen Stats, Sneed allowed no touchdowns and a league-low four yards per target while in zone coverage in 2023.
According to Tyler Dragon of USA Today, the Chiefs have received inquiries on Sneed from the Indianapolis Colts, Minnesota Vikings, New England Patriots, Atlanta Falcons, Jacksonville Jaguars, Detroit Lions and Tennessee Titans. If Sneed is traded, Kansas City is expected to receive a 2024 second-round pick in exchange, at a minimum. https://sportsnaut.com/ljarius-sneed...fs-rumors/amp/ |

Sneed doesn't have a NTC or anything - but he can really control his landing by choosing to extent or not. Unless some team (maybe Detroit) is willing to give a high pick for him and take their chances on a 1 year scenario, he's going to be able to sink any trade offers by refusing to sign an extension. But ultimately I think he'd have to realize that's a bit of a bluff. He can't risk not signing long-term right now - this is his 'strike while the iron is hot' moment. If he plays on the tag, he's guaranteed about $20 million. If he signs the Jaylon Johnson deal, he's guaranteed north of $50 million. He'd be foolish to dig his heels in here. |
